Progress on Jammu-Akhnoor National Highway reviewed

Divisional Commissioner, Sanjeev Verma, Friday held a meeting to review the progress on Jammu-Akhnoor National Highway project.

It was informed in the meeting that Jammu-Akhnoor NationalHighway project has two phases. “In the first phase, 5.2 kilometre-longflyover, starting from Canal Head to Muthi will be constructed at an estimatedcost of Rs 273 crore and will be completed by Feb 2021. Similarly, in secondphase, a four-lane highway will be constructed from Muthi to Akhnoor at anestimated cost of Rs 194 crore by July 2021,” the meeting was told.

   

It was informed by the liaison officers from NHIDCL thataround 90 percent of land adjoining four-lane project has been cleared andhanded over to them.

Regarding felling of trees, the concerned officers informedthat out of 1539 trees only 375 are left, which will be cut off soon.

Issues related to pending structures, land possession,compensations, shifting of towers and other allied matters were also discussedin the meeting. Emphasizing on adherence to quality specification and timelycompletion of the projects, the Div Com directed the concerned departments towork in synergy and ensure regular monitoring of the works.
